public class PermissioningLogger
extends java.lang.Object
setLogger(LoggerProvider) to redirect log messages to your LoggerProvider.
If you want to log to the same log as the PermissioningDatasource you can use PermissioningLogger.log[level](...) within
your code.| Modifier and Type | Method and Description |
|---|---|
static void |
logDebug(java.lang.String message)
Log a debug level message
|
static void |
logDebug(java.lang.String message,
java.lang.Object... args)
Log an info level message with items to be incorporated into the message string
|
static void |
logError(java.lang.String message)
Log an error level message
|
static void |
logError(java.lang.String message,
java.lang.Throwable t)
Log an error level message with items to be incorporated into the message string
|
static void |
logInfo(java.lang.String message)
Log an info level message
|
static void |
logInfo(java.lang.String message,
java.lang.Object... args)
Log an info level message with items to be incorporated into the message string
|
static void |
logWarn(java.lang.String message)
Log an warn level message
|
static void |
logWarn(java.lang.String message,
java.lang.Object... args)
Log a warn level message with items to be incorporated into the message string
|
static void |
setLogger(LoggerProvider logger)
Set the
LoggerProvider that the LoggerProvider will use. |
public static void setLogger(LoggerProvider logger)
LoggerProvider that the LoggerProvider will use.logger - The PermissioningLogger to use when logging.public static void logError(java.lang.String message)
message - public static void logError(java.lang.String message,
java.lang.Throwable t)
message - the message (non-parameterised)t - the Throwable to be loggedpublic static void logWarn(java.lang.String message)
message - public static void logWarn(java.lang.String message,
java.lang.Object... args)
message - the message in the form "user name was: {0}"args - the arguments to substitute into the message e.g. user.getName();public static void logInfo(java.lang.String message)
message - public static void logInfo(java.lang.String message,
java.lang.Object... args)
message - args - public static void logDebug(java.lang.String message)
message - public static void logDebug(java.lang.String message,
java.lang.Object... args)
message - the message in the form "user name was: {0}"args - the arguments to substitute into the message e.g. user.getName();Please send bug reports and comments to Caplin support